AngelList, established in 2010, is a U.S.-based online platform that connects startups, angel investors, and job seekers. It operates as the parent company of AngelList Venture, AngelList Talent, and Product Hunt, boasting over 20 unicorns in its portfolio. The platform supports millions of job seekers in their search and has facilitated the launch of over 100,000 products. Additionally, AngelList India serves as a platform for fundraising, recruitment, and product launches.

Otta is an online job portal focused on improving the job search experience for candidates, particularly within the tech sector. By prioritizing the needs of job seekers over those of companies, Otta aims to provide a fulfilling and user-friendly platform for finding employment. The portal offers personalized job recommendations based on individual preferences and saved searches, allowing candidates to find roles that align with their goals. Otta addresses common frustrations in the job market, such as the lack of salary transparency and diversity data in job listings, by implementing features that enhance the overall job search experience. Since its launch in January 2020, Otta has rapidly expanded, increasing from 1,000 applications sent per month to thousands daily across the UK and the US. As Otta continues to grow, it plans to broaden its scope beyond tech companies to assist more candidates in their job search journey.

Braintrust is a blockchain-based freelancer marketplace that connects technical and design professionals with organizations seeking their expertise. Founded in 2018 in San Jose, California, by Adam Jackson, Gabriel Luna-Ostaseski, and Brian Flynn, Braintrust offers a user-controlled talent network that eliminates intermediaries, allowing companies to save significantly on hiring costs. The platform enables direct connections between enterprises and highly skilled talent, ensuring that freelancers retain 100 percent of their earnings while the company charges a flat 10 percent project fee. Braintrust aims to disrupt traditional hiring practices by creating a transparent and efficient ecosystem that aligns the interests of both talent and organizations, facilitating access to the right professionals based on verified reputations and work histories.

Glassdoor, Inc. is an online jobs and career community that facilitates connections between job seekers, employees, and employers. Founded in June 2007 and headquartered in Mill Valley, California, the company provides a platform where users can access job listings and contribute user-generated content, such as company reviews, salary reports, CEO approval ratings, and interview insights. This information helps individuals make informed career decisions. Glassdoor operates in various sectors, including administrative, engineering, finance, healthcare, IT, and sales. In addition to its website, the service is accessible via mobile applications on iOS and Android platforms. With a global presence, Glassdoor also has offices in several major cities, including San Francisco, Chicago, Toronto, London, and São Paulo. As of June 2018, it operates as a subsidiary of Recruit Holdings Co., Ltd.

Navent is a company that operates online job and real estate portals across several Latin American countries, including Argentina, Brazil, Chile, Ecuador, Mexico, Panama, Peru, and Venezuela. Founded in 1999 by Alejandro Navarro and Nicolas Tejerina, with its headquarters in Buenos Aires, the company provides job listings and employment solutions tailored for individuals seeking jobs and companies looking to fill positions, particularly in the IT sector and for professionals and executives. In addition to its job portals, Navent also offers a platform for buying, selling, and renting properties, allowing real estate agencies and individuals to list their offerings while helping users find suitable properties. Furthermore, the company develops software solutions, including CRM systems and website design and hosting services, specifically for the real estate industry, enhancing its overall service offerings.
